Common Causes of Motorcycle Accidents

Speeding

Speeding is a major contributing factor to motorcycle accidents. When motorcyclists exceed the speed limit, they have less time to react to unexpected situations, making it more difficult to avoid collisions. Additionally, speeding reduces the stability and control of the motorcycle, increasing the risk of losing control and crashing. It is important for motorcyclists to always obey the speed limits and ride at a safe and appropriate speed to minimize the chances of being involved in an accident.

Factors Contributing to Motorcycle Accidents

Lack of visibility

Lack of visibility is a significant factor contributing to motorcycle accidents. Motorcycles are smaller and less visible than other vehicles on the road, making it harder for drivers to see them. This lack of visibility increases the risk of collisions, especially in situations where drivers are not actively looking out for motorcycles. Additionally, poor weather conditions, such as fog or rain, can further reduce visibility and increase the chances of accidents. It is crucial for both motorcyclists and other drivers to be aware of this issue and take necessary precautions to improve visibility on the road.

Road conditions

Motorcycle accidents can be influenced by various factors, including road conditions. The condition of the road plays a crucial role in the safety of motorcyclists. Poorly maintained roads, potholes, uneven surfaces, and debris can increase the risk of accidents. Slippery road conditions due to rain, snow, or oil spills can also make it more challenging for motorcyclists to maintain control of their bikes. Additionally, road construction zones can present hazards such as loose gravel or uneven pavement. It is important for motorcyclists to be aware of the road conditions and adjust their riding accordingly to ensure their safety on the road.

Impact of Motorcycle Accidents

Injuries and fatalities

Injuries and fatalities are a significant concern in motorcycle accidents. According to the latest statistics, motorcycle riders are more vulnerable to severe injuries and fatalities compared to occupants of other vehicles. The lack of protective barriers and the exposed nature of motorcycles make riders more susceptible to impact forces and collisions. Head injuries, including traumatic brain injuries, are among the most common and severe injuries sustained in motorcycle accidents. Additionally, the absence of seat belts and airbags further increases the risk of fatal injuries. It is crucial for both riders and drivers to be aware of these risks and take necessary precautions to ensure their safety on the road.

Prevention and Safety Measures

Wearing protective gear

Wearing protective gear is essential for motorcycle riders to ensure their safety on the road. Helmets, for instance, play a crucial role in preventing head injuries during accidents. Studies have shown that wearing a helmet can reduce the risk of head injury by up to 69% and the risk of death by up to 42%. In addition to helmets, riders should also wear appropriate clothing, such as jackets, pants, gloves, and boots, to protect their body from abrasions and fractures in the event of a crash. By wearing protective gear, motorcyclists can significantly reduce the severity of injuries and increase their chances of survival in accidents.

Safe riding practices

Safe riding practices are crucial for preventing motorcycle accidents and ensuring the safety of riders. By following these practices, riders can significantly reduce the risk of accidents and minimize the severity of injuries. Wearing a helmet is one of the most important safety measures, as it protects the head and reduces the chances of a fatal head injury. Additionally, maintaining a safe distance from other vehicles, obeying traffic laws, and using turn signals can help riders avoid collisions. Regularly checking the motorcycle’s brakes, tires, and lights is also essential to ensure that the bike is in proper working condition. Finally, staying alert and focused while riding, avoiding distractions, and never riding under the influence of alcohol or drugs are key elements of safe riding practices. By adopting these practices, riders can enjoy the thrill of motorcycle riding while minimizing the risks involved.

Motorcycle maintenance

Motorcycle maintenance is a crucial aspect of ensuring rider safety and preventing accidents. Regular maintenance, such as checking tire pressure, inspecting brakes, and changing oil, helps to identify and address any potential issues before they become major problems. Additionally, proper maintenance can improve the overall performance and longevity of the motorcycle. By following the manufacturer’s recommended maintenance schedule and staying proactive with upkeep, riders can significantly reduce the risk of accidents caused by mechanical failures or malfunctions. It is important for all motorcycle owners to prioritize regular maintenance to ensure a safe and enjoyable riding experience.
